Understanding Grip Strength
Grip strength, at its core, is the measure of the force exerted by your hand to grip an object. It's a seemingly simple function, but it's actually a complex interplay of muscles in your forearm, hand, and even shoulder. This force is crucial for countless daily tasks, from opening jars and carrying groceries to performing exercises and participating in sports That's the part that actually makes a difference..
Grip strength is typically assessed using a device called a dynamometer. This handheld tool measures the maximum isometric strength of your hand muscles. Consider this: essentially, you squeeze the dynamometer as hard as you can, and it registers the peak force you generate. This reading provides a quantifiable measure of your grip strength, usually expressed in kilograms (kg) or pounds (lbs).
There are several types of grip strength, though the most commonly measured is static grip strength. This refers to the maximum force you can maintain for a short period without any movement. Other types include:
- Crush grip: The ability to squeeze something between your fingers and palm, like crushing a can.
- Pinch grip: The strength to hold something between your thumb and fingers, like picking up a coin.
- Support grip: The ability to hold onto something for an extended period, like carrying a heavy bag.
While all these types are important, static grip strength is the most frequently tested and researched, making it the primary focus of this article Worth keeping that in mind..
Factors Influencing Grip Strength in Males
Grip strength isn't a fixed attribute; it's influenced by a variety of factors, some of which are within your control and others that aren't. Understanding these factors can help you contextualize your own grip strength and identify areas for potential improvement.
- Age: Grip strength typically peaks in your 20s and 30s, then gradually declines with age. This is a natural part of the aging process, as muscle mass and strength tend to decrease over time. Even so, the rate of decline can be significantly influenced by lifestyle factors.
- Sex: Men generally have greater grip strength than women due to hormonal differences (particularly testosterone) and typically larger muscle mass. This difference is especially pronounced after puberty.
- Hand Size: Generally, individuals with larger hands tend to have greater grip strength, as they have more muscle mass in their hands and forearms.
- Dominance: Your dominant hand will typically exhibit greater grip strength than your non-dominant hand. This is due to the increased use and training of the dominant hand in everyday activities.
- Occupation and Activity Level: Individuals who work in jobs that require repetitive gripping or lifting, or who regularly engage in strength training exercises, tend to have stronger grips. Construction workers, weightlifters, and rock climbers are prime examples.
- Overall Health: Underlying health conditions can significantly impact grip strength. Conditions like arthritis, carpal tunnel syndrome, and nerve damage can all weaken the hand and reduce grip strength. Systemic diseases, such as diabetes and heart disease, have also been linked to reduced grip strength.
- Nutrition: Adequate protein intake is crucial for muscle growth and repair, which directly impacts grip strength. Deficiencies in essential nutrients can hinder muscle function and reduce overall strength.
- Training and Exercise: Specific grip strength training exercises, as well as general strength training, can significantly improve grip strength. These exercises target the muscles in the hand, forearm, and upper arm, leading to increased strength and endurance.
- Genetics: Like many physical traits, genetics play a role in determining your potential for grip strength. Some individuals are simply predisposed to having stronger grips due to their genetic makeup.
- Motivation and Effort: Your level of motivation and effort during a grip strength test can also influence your score. A maximal effort is essential for obtaining an accurate assessment of your true grip strength.
How Grip Strength is Measured
As mentioned earlier, grip strength is typically measured using a dynamometer. There are several types of dynamometers, but the hydraulic hand dynamometer is the most common and widely used in research and clinical settings.
Here's a general overview of the grip strength testing procedure:
- Preparation: The individual being tested is typically seated comfortably with their feet flat on the floor and their arm bent at a 90-degree angle. The elbow should be supported to ensure proper positioning.
- Dynamometer Adjustment: The dynamometer is adjusted to fit the individual's hand size. Most dynamometers have adjustable handles to accommodate different hand sizes and ensure a comfortable and effective grip.
- Testing Procedure: The individual is instructed to squeeze the dynamometer as hard as they can for a few seconds. make sure to provide clear instructions and encouragement to ensure a maximal effort.
- Multiple Trials: Typically, two or three trials are performed with each hand, with a short rest period between each trial. This allows the muscles to recover and reduces the risk of fatigue.
- Recording Results: The highest score from each hand is recorded. The results are usually expressed in kilograms (kg) or pounds (lbs).
- Averaging Results: If multiple trials are conducted, the average score for each hand can be calculated. This provides a more reliable measure of grip strength.
don't forget to follow a standardized protocol when measuring grip strength to ensure accurate and reliable results. Factors such as hand position, arm position, and the type of dynamometer used can all influence the outcome.
Average Grip Strength for Males: Age-Based Breakdown
So, what is the average grip strength for a male? The answer isn't a single number; it varies depending on age. Here's a breakdown of average grip strength for males across different age groups, based on various studies and research:
| Age Group | Average Grip Strength (kg) | Average Grip Strength (lbs) |
|---|---|---|
| 20-29 | 51 | 112 |
| 30-39 | 50 | 110 |
| 40-49 | 48 | 106 |
| 50-59 | 45 | 99 |
| 60-69 | 42 | 93 |
| 70-79 | 37 | 81 |
| 80+ | 30 | 66 |
Note: These are approximate averages and can vary depending on the study and population.
Interpreting the Data:
- As you can see, grip strength tends to peak in the 20s and 30s, then gradually declines with age. This is consistent with the general trend of muscle strength and mass decreasing with age.
- it helps to remember that these are just averages. Individual grip strength can vary significantly depending on the factors discussed earlier, such as occupation, activity level, and overall health.
- If your grip strength falls significantly below the average for your age group, it may be worth consulting with a healthcare professional to rule out any underlying health conditions.
Grip Strength as an Indicator of Overall Health
Grip strength isn't just a measure of hand strength; it's increasingly recognized as a valuable indicator of overall health and well-being. Research has linked grip strength to a variety of health outcomes, including:
- Mortality: Numerous studies have shown a strong correlation between grip strength and mortality. Lower grip strength is associated with an increased risk of death from all causes, including cardiovascular disease, cancer, and respiratory disease.
- Cardiovascular Health: Grip strength has been linked to cardiovascular health markers, such as blood pressure and heart rate variability. Lower grip strength may indicate a higher risk of cardiovascular events, such as heart attack and stroke.
- Muscle Mass and Strength: Grip strength is a good indicator of overall muscle mass and strength. It can be used to assess sarcopenia, the age-related loss of muscle mass and strength, which is a major risk factor for falls, disability, and mortality.
- Cognitive Function: Some studies have suggested a link between grip strength and cognitive function. Lower grip strength may be associated with poorer cognitive performance and an increased risk of cognitive decline.
- Bone Density: Grip strength has been linked to bone density, particularly in older adults. Lower grip strength may indicate a higher risk of osteoporosis and fractures.
- Functional Ability: Grip strength is essential for performing many daily tasks, such as opening jars, carrying groceries, and dressing oneself. Lower grip strength can impair functional ability and reduce independence.
These findings highlight the importance of maintaining adequate grip strength throughout life. It's not just about being able to open a stubborn jar; it's about preserving your overall health and quality of life Small thing, real impact..
How to Improve Your Grip Strength
The good news is that grip strength can be improved with targeted training and lifestyle modifications. Here are some effective strategies for increasing your grip strength:
-
Grip Strength Exercises:
- Hand Grippers: These are inexpensive and portable devices that allow you to squeeze against resistance. Start with a lower resistance and gradually increase it as your grip strength improves.
- Dead Hangs: Hang from a pull-up bar for as long as possible. This exercise challenges your support grip and strengthens your forearms and shoulders.
- Towel Pull-Ups: Drape a towel over a pull-up bar and grip the ends of the towel to perform pull-ups. This variation increases the difficulty and engages your grip muscles more intensely.
- Plate Pinches: Pinch weight plates together between your thumb and fingers. Start with lighter plates and gradually increase the weight as your grip strength improves.
- Rice Bucket Exercises: Fill a bucket with rice and perform various hand and wrist exercises, such as squeezing, gripping, and rotating your hand in the rice. This provides a unique form of resistance training.
-
Strength Training Exercises: Many compound exercises, such as deadlifts, rows, and pull-ups, indirectly train your grip muscles. Using a thicker bar (or adding grip-enhancing attachments) can further increase the grip challenge.
-
Use Hand Strengtheners: Devices like stress balls or putty can be used for squeezing exercises to improve grip endurance and circulation.
-
Modify Your Activities: Be mindful of your grip in everyday activities. Here's one way to look at it: consciously grip your steering wheel tighter or carry groceries without using plastic bags (if possible) Simple, but easy to overlook..
-
Proper Nutrition: Ensure you're consuming enough protein to support muscle growth and repair. Also, include plenty of fruits, vegetables, and healthy fats in your diet to provide essential nutrients for overall health No workaround needed..
-
Address Underlying Health Conditions: If you have any underlying health conditions that may be affecting your grip strength, such as arthritis or carpal tunnel syndrome, seek medical treatment to manage these conditions.
-
Consistency is Key: Like any form of training, consistency is essential for improving grip strength. Aim to incorporate grip strength exercises into your routine several times per week for optimal results.
